, a mechanical engineer and rock hound.Terzaghi additionally created the structure for theories of bearing ability of structures, and the theory for prediction of the rate of settlement of clay layers as a result of loan consolidation. Afterwards, Maurice Biot fully developed the three-dimensional dirt combination theory, extending the one-dimensional model previously developed by Terzaghi to more basic hypotheses and introducing the set of fundamental equations of Poroelasticity.
Geotechnical engineers investigate and establish the homes of subsurface problems and materials. They likewise develop matching earthworks and maintaining structures, tunnels, and framework foundations, and might oversee and evaluate websites, which might further involve site surveillance along with the danger assessment and mitigation of natural dangers. Geotechnical designers and engineering rock hounds carry out geotechnical investigations to get details on the physical residential properties of dirt and rock underlying and beside a website to make earthworks and foundations for proposed structures and for the repair service of distress to earthworks and frameworks triggered by subsurface conditions.

Geologic mapping and interpretation of geomorphology are normally completed in assessment with a geologist or engineering geologist. Subsurface expedition generally entails in-situ testing (for instance, the standard infiltration examination and cone penetration examination). The digging of test pits and trenching (specifically for finding mistakes and slide planes) might additionally be utilized to find out about dirt conditions at deepness. Still, they are sometimes made use of to allow a rock hound or engineer to be reduced right into the borehole for straight aesthetic and hands-on exam of the dirt and rock stratigraphy. Various soil samplers exist to satisfy the needs of different engineering projects. The basic infiltration test, which uses a thick-walled split spoon sampler, is the most usual means to gather disrupted samples.

If the user interface in between the mass and the base of a slope has a complex geometry, slope stability evaluation is tough and numerical solution techniques are needed. Normally, the interface's precise geometry is unidentified, and a simplified interface geometry is thought. Limited inclines need three-dimensional designs to be assessed, so most slopes are examined assuming that they are considerably broad and can be stood for by two-dimensional designs.

Engineering the buildings and technicians of rocks consisting of the application of characteristics, fluid technicians, kinematics and product mechanics. This combines geology, soil and rock auto mechanics, and architectural engineering for the layout and building of foundations for a range of civil design jobs. This area includes anticipating the efficiency of foundation soil and rock to a lots enforced by a framework, while taking into consideration performance, economy and safety.

A geologist would need to re-train to become a geotechnical engineer, although there is lots of cross-over between both occupations, which might make this simpler. Geologists need to have an understanding of dirts, rocks and other products from a clinical perspective, while geotechnical designers tale their understanding of matters such as soil and rock mechanic, geophysics and hydrology and use them to design and environmental tasks.
When starting out, these engineers will tend to service much less complicated tasks, accumulating understanding and experience ready for more difficult job later on. Geotechnical engineers have a tendency to be experts in certain areas as they expand in experience, focusing on certain frameworks such as trains, roadways or water. These engineers likewise home collaborate with renewable energy, offshore and onshore oil and gas, nuclear power, and more.
